Model view bugs

Hi all,

The data model for one of my files has gone haywire. When I first open it no connections are visible. If I move fact tables around, the connections suddenly appear, odd. One of my fact tables I recently added can’t be moved and when i click it the expand/collapse the views go weird:

1.png

 

 

If I move my dim tables the connections don’t move with them:

 

3.png2.png

 

This is only affecting one of my files. I upgraded to the July PBI version, don’t know if it’s related but it happened after the upgrade.

Any idea how to solve?
